Hi Ty,
To be honest, you may need to hire a Local SEO to figure this out one-on-one with you. There are so many reasons a listing can drop or disappear. I will give a few ideas here, but this should by no means be considered as coverage of all the things that could cause this:
-
You've failed to hide the address of a business that Google knows or believes doesn't serve customers at the place of business (i.e. the client has a go-to-client business model like a carpet cleaning company or dog walker). This can cause listings to be totally pulled.
-
You have unknowingly violated a different guideline.
-
The listing isn't actually not there...it exists but is buried so deep, you're just not finding it.
-
The listing has merged with listing of one of the other branches in the business, or with that of a totally unrelated business.
-
Duplicate listings may have caused the listing to drop out of site.
This is just the tip of the iceberg, and as you can see, it's hard to diagnose anything like this without a hands on investigation of the issue.
I do have a couple of recommendations for you to get you a little further along on your path.
